阅读以下关于基于嵌入式系统的住宅安全系统的技术说明,根据要求回答问题1至问题4。 【说明】 基于某嵌入式系统的住宅安全系统可使用传感器(如红外探头和摄像头等)来检测各种意外情况,如非法进入、火警及水灾等。 房主可以在安装该系统时配置安全监控设

admin2009-02-15  31

问题 阅读以下关于基于嵌入式系统的住宅安全系统的技术说明,根据要求回答问题1至问题4。
【说明】
   基于某嵌入式系统的住宅安全系统可使用传感器(如红外探头和摄像头等)来检测各种意外情况,如非法进入、火警及水灾等。
   房主可以在安装该系统时配置安全监控设备(如传感器、显示器和报警器等),也可以在系统运行时修改配置,通过录像机和电视机监控与系统连接的所有传感器,并通过控制面板上的键盘与系统进行信息交互。在安装过程中,系统给每个传感器赋予一个D编号和类型,
并设置房主密码以启动和关闭系统,设置传感器事件发生时应自动拨出的电话号码。当系统检测到一个传感器事件时,就激活警报,拨出预置的电话号码,并报告关于位置和检测到的事件的性质等信息。图6-19所示是住宅安全系统的顶层数据流图,图6-20所示是住宅安全系统的第0层数据流图,图 6-21所示是对住宅安全系统的第0层数据流图中加工4的细化图。

选项

答案(A)用户配置请求 (B)TV信号 (C)告警类型 (D)传感器 (E)传感器状态 这是一道要求读者掌握分层数据流图中数据流的平衡原则的综合分析题。本题的解答思路如下: ①本题的图6-19并不是完整的顶层数据流图,解答时需通过题干的说明信息以及第。层数据流图来分析顶层图并解答问题。 ②题干中提及的关键信息“房主可以在安装该系统时配置安全监控设备(如传感器、显示器和报警器等)”,在顶层数据流图(图6-19)中这3个名词并没有完整地出现,仅出现了“报警器”一词。在图6-19中“电视机”实际上起题干中关键信息“显示器”的作用。结合图6-19中“传感器状态”这一输出数据流可判断出(D)空缺处应填入“传感器”这一外部实体。 ③由于子层数据流图是其父数据流图中某一部分内部的细节图(或加工图),因此子层数据流图的输入/输出数据流应该保持一致,即在上一级数据流图中有几条数据流,其子图也一定有同样的数据流,而且它们的输送方向是一致的。 ④在住宅安全系统第0层数据流图(图6-20)中,加工5(信息及状态显示)的输出数据流为“TV信号”,其中“TV”是日常生活中电视机的英文缩写。在图6-19顶层数据流图中有一外部实体——“录像机、电视机”,因此可推理出图6-19中(B)空缺处的数据流就是“TV信号”。 ⑤根据数据流的方向可知,在图6-19所示的顶层数据流图中(C)空缺处的数据流属于输出数据流。在第0层数据流图(图6-20)中,共有“TV信号”、“电话拨号”、“告警类型”和“显示信息”四个输出数据流。在图6-19顶层数据流图中现已存在“TV信号”、“电话拨号”和“显示信息”三个输出数据流,因此可推理出图6-19中流向“报警器”外部实体的数据流是“告警类型”,即(C)空缺处填写的数据流应是“告警类型”。 ⑥根据数据流的方向可知,在图6-20所示的第0层数据流图中(E)空缺处的数据流属于输入数据流,且与“传感器监控”这一加工处理相关。在图6-19顶层数据流图中,外部实体“传感器”流入“住宅安全系统”的输入数据流是“传感器状态”,由此可推理出图 6-19中(E)空缺处的数据流就是“传感器状态”。 ⑦同理,根据数据流的方向可知,在图6-19所示的顶层数据流图中(A)空缺处的数据流属于输入数据流。在第0层数据流图(图6-20)中流入“住宅安全系统”加工的输入数据流共有四个,分别是“用户配置请求”、“开始/停止”、“用户密码”和“传感器状态”等。在图6-19所示的顶层数据流图中现已存在有“开始/停止”、“用户密码”和“传感器状态”三个输出数据流,因此可推理出图6-19中由“控制面板”外部实体流出的数据流是“用户配置请求”,即(A)空缺处填写的数据流应是“用户配置请求”。 ⑧将以上分析结果归纳整理成图6-23所示的完整的住宅安全系统顶层数据流图。 [*]

解析
转载请注明原文地址:https://kaotiyun.com/show/fmWZ777K
0

最新回复(0)